Sydney – The Family Majesty of Sydney
The walkways of Sydney shimmer against the colorful turquoise waters of the Pacific Ocean. The iconic Sydney Opera House rises above the brick esplanade with a roof imitating illustrious sails. A replica of Captain Cook’s ship adorns Darling Harbour, representing the country’s absorbing seafaring history amidst galleries highlighting indigenous maritime culture. Your flight lands at Sydney Airport where your private transfer meets the family upon your arrival. The city bustles with culture, from art galleries in the neighborhood of Newtown to the late 19th-century arcades of the Queen Victoria Building in the Central Business District. Sydney Tower adorns the skyline, reaching a height of more than 1,000 feet above the city streets.
You settle into a luxurious hotel overlooking the passing boats of the harbor, accentuated by the steel frame of the Sydney Harbour Bridge’s lavish arch. Your guide meets you at the hotel, eager to introduce the family to the remarkable history of Australia’s oldest city, beginning in the Rocks district. The aroma of freshly baked macaroons emanates from the local patisserie edging the walkway of the outdoor shopping center. Sandstone brick warehouses erected in the 19th century continue to decorate the streets. The kids marvel at the tales the guide tells of the first people who looked out over the rocky bay in the 1770s to see the soaring sails of the HMB Endeavour, Captain Cook’s famous research vessel.

Detailed Description
Let the family indulge in splendor and adventure on your Australian discovery tour, where the captivating Great Barrier Reef and endless sands of the Red Centre are as majestic as the legends telling of the continent’s creation. The rhythmic vibrations of the didgeridoo hum beneath unfettered starlight. Loggerhead turtles graze on sea grass sweeping across the ocean floor. Koalas lounge in eucalyptus trees and crocodiles linger in rivers, camouflaged amongst the rainforest underbrush. The family will find thrills and a relaxing ambiance, historic neighborhoods and newfound surf-skills while exploring the culture, landscape, and seaside splendors of the Land Down Under.
The journey begins with the family’s arrival at Sydney Airport. Your private transfer escorts you to a luxurious hotel offering remarkable views of Sydney Harbour and Circular Quay. After settling into the hotel, the family embarks on an introductory tour of Sydney, following your guide through the historical neighborhood of the Rocks and the beauty of the Royal Botanic Gardens. The next morning, you have a private half-day tour of Sydney’s thrilling neighborhoods to view the culture, history, and architecture of Australia’s oldest city. Partake in a private surfing lesson at Bondi Beach before boarding a boat for an afternoon cruise around the harbor. Next, you take to the countryside on a private excursion to Blue Mountains National Park. The family delights in the sandstone plateaus, waterfalls, and eucalyptus trees before visiting the Featherdale Wildlife Park.
Your private transfer leads the family from the hotel to Sydney Airport. Your flight takes you into the Red Centre at Uluru, also referred to as Ayers Rock. The family ventures to a luxurious hotel in view of the mystical monolith of Uluru rising out of the desert landscape where you can enjoy a sunset tour. The family rises early for a camel trekking tour around Uluru to watch the sunrise. In the afternoon, you continue your discoveries of the desert at Kata Tjuta. Indulge in the myths and cuisine of a dinner beneath the immaculate starlight. You travel to the airstrip for your flight to Cairns. Upon your arrival, your private transfer escorts you north to a resort in Daintree Rainforest overlooking Mossman River.
The family traverses the rainforest trails on a guided tour before taking to the Mossman River on a crocodile-spotting cruise. Fly from Cairns to Hayman Island, located in the Whitsundays Archipelago. The remainder of the day is at your leisure for the family to indulge in the splendors of the island resort. The family can enjoy endless activities offered by the resort, from trekking to visit Blue Pearl Bay to paddle boarding near the shore. You could also sail to other Whitsunday Islands for the day.
Afterward, the family sets sail on a catamaran for a full day exploring the Great Barrier Reef. Scour the hard and soft coral to find angelfish, sea turtles, and blue tang before returning to your island resort. The day is at the family’s leisure to relax or explore at your preferred pace. Trek the trails of the island to reach Cook Lookout or you relish a massage while the kids bask in the sand. The family makes their way to the airstrip on the final day to board your flight and make your way home.
